An attacker infiltrated the code base of a hardware manufacturer and inserted malware before the code was compiled. The malicious code is now running at the hardware level across a number of industries and sectors. Which of the following categories BEST describes this type of vendor risk?

A. SDLC attack

B. Side-load attack

C. Remote code signing

D. Supply chain attack








 

Suggested Answer: C

Community Answer: D
